+

set_field_init

+       sets  a  hook to be called at form-post time and each time the selected
+       field changes (after the change).
+
+
+

field_init

+       returns the current field init hook, if any (NULL if there is  no  such
+       hook).
+
+
+

set_field_term

+       sets a hook to be called at form-unpost time and each time the selected
+       field changes (before the change).
+
+
+

field_term

+       returns the current field term hook, if any (NULL if there is  no  such
+       hook).
+
+
+

set_form_init

+       sets a hook to be called at form-post time and just after a page change
+       once it is posted.
+
+
+

form_init

+       returns the current form init hook, if any (NULL if there  is  no  such
+       hook).
 
-       The  function  set_form_init sets a hook to be called at form-post time
-       and just after a page change once it is posted.  form_init returns  the
-       current form init hook, if any (NULL if there is no such hook).
 
-       The function set_form_term sets a hook to be called at form-unpost time
-       and just before a page change once it is posted.  form_init returns the
-       current form term hook, if any (NULL if there is no such hook).
+

set_form_term

+       sets  a  hook  to  be called at form-unpost time and just before a page
+       change once it is posted.
+
+
+

form_term

+       returns the current form term hook, if any (NULL if there  is  no  such
+       hook).
